Finance Review Summary — Varnholt Supply Contract

The renewal with Varnholt Components was reviewed against last year's spend. Unit pricing rises 3.1%, partly offset by improved payment terms (net 60). Volume commitments remain unchanged, and the exclusivity clause on the Kestrel line has been dropped, giving us sourcing flexibility from Q3. Finance recommends approval; total annual exposure stays within the approved envelope. Sales leads should note the revised lead times when quoting. The following note is for internal planning only.

internal memo for kaduf-baduf: Only 35 of the 378 pilot accounts renewed Holir, so a churn review is set for June 11. Eliielax Group is in early talks to buy Silaelix Group for about $142.1 million.

// Fixture: kiosk watchdog restart cycle (Pondera terminals).
// Simulates three missed heartbeats, expects watchdog to
// relaunch the shell within 8s and emit a single restart event.
// Do not cut a release if this flakes — it gates the Brindle
// rollout. The fixture calls the staging watchdog API using
// the bearer token below.

session JWT of yawep-yawep = eyJhbGciOiJIUzI1NiIsInR5cCI6IkpXVCJ9.eyJzdWIiOiI3pWF3_In0.aXYsHiog

MEMO — Reseller Programme Overview

For the incoming director: the Caldera reseller programme currently covers thirty-one partners across three tiers, with margins of 12–22% depending on certification level. Onboarding is handled by Sela Orrin's team; attrition has been low but tier-two engagement is weak. We are reviewing the rebate structure and considering a dedicated partner portal. A full partner-by-partner assessment is scheduled for next month. The confidential note on programme direction appears immediately below.

confidential, kagup-bafog: Fraaxax Group is in early talks to buy Soroxox Group for about $343.8 million. The Olidor launch date is June 14, and nothing goes to the press before then. Legal wants the Aldmirek Logistics term sheet signed before July 23.